1核2G服务器可以挂几个网站?

1核2G的服务器理论上可以支持多个小型或中型网站,但具体数量取决于每个网站的资源消耗情况,包括访问量、数据库查询频率、页面复杂度等因素。

在实际应用中,1核2G的服务器配置属于入门级,适合用于个人博客、小型企业网站等低至中等流量的站点。这类服务器通常能够处理几十到上百个静态网页,或者几个动态但访问量不大的网站。例如,一个简单的WordPress博客,如果每天的访问量不超过几千次,这样的配置通常是足够的。

然而,如果网站包含大量动态内容、数据库操作频繁、使用了复杂的前端技术(如大量的JavaScript和CSS),或者有较高的并发访问需求,那么1核2G的服务器可能会显得力不从心。在这种情况下,服务器的CPU和内存资源可能会迅速耗尽,导致网站响应变慢甚至无法访问。

为了更具体地评估1核2G服务器能支持多少个网站,可以从以下几个方面进行考虑:

  1. 网站类型:静态网站比动态网站对服务器资源的需求要低得多。纯HTML页面几乎不会消耗服务器的计算资源,而动态生成的内容则需要更多的CPU和内存来处理请求。

  2. 访问量:网站的每日访问量是决定服务器负载的关键因素。低流量的网站(如个人博客)可能只需要很少的资源,而高流量的网站则需要更多的计算能力和带宽。

  3. 数据库使用:如果网站使用数据库存储数据,频繁的数据库查询会显著增加服务器的负载。优化数据库查询和使用缓存技术可以有效减少资源消耗。

  4. 资源优化:通过优化代码、减少HTTP请求、使用CDN(内容分发网络)、启用Gzip压缩等手段,可以提高服务器的性能,支持更多的网站运行在同一台服务器上。

  5. 监控与调整:定期监控服务器的资源使用情况,如CPU利用率、内存使用率和磁盘I/O,可以帮助及时发现并解决问题。当资源使用接近上限时,考虑升级服务器配置或采用负载均衡技术分散压力。

综上所述,1核2G的服务器可以支持多个网站,但具体数量需要根据网站的类型、访问量和技术实现等因素综合考虑。合理规划和资源优化是确保服务器稳定运行的关键。